P5.1-M worth of drugs seized in Cebu

CEBU CITY — More than PHP5 million worth of “shabu” were taken off Cebu City’s streets last week when policemen confiscated some 434.61 grams on May 21-27.

In the weekly accomplishment report of the Cebu City Police released Tuesday, the Dangerous Drugs Board valued the haul at PHP5.12 million.

The bulk of the drug haul was recovered by Police Station 10 in Punta Princesa, which seized a total of 300.08 grams of “shabu”, also known as methamphetamine hydrochloride, worth PHP3.54 million in Barangay Tisa during a joint operation with the city police’s Drug Enforcement Unit last week.

The Punta Princesa Police also seized .56 grams of “shabu” valued at PHP6,608 in Barangay Labangon, while Police Station 4 in Mabolo confiscated 54.74 grams worth PHP645,932 – broken down into 52.38 grams (PHP618,084) in Barangay Luz and 2.36 grams (PHP27,848) in Barangay Lahug.

The City Intelligence Branch (CIB) also seized 28.26 grams of “shabu” worth PHP333,468 in Barangay Ermita last week., while Police Station 6 recovered PHP290,280 worth of drugs or 24.92 grams.

Police Station 6 confiscated 20.32 grams valued at PHP236,000 in Barangay Pasil, 4.32 grams (PHP50,976) in Barangay Pahina Central, and .28 grams (PHP3,304) in Barangay Suba. (With Bebie Jane Casipong/PNA)
